On average across the year,
no, Montana, United States is not hotter than
Revere, Massachusetts
.
Montana, United States has an average temperature of 7°C/45°F and Revere, Massachusetts has an average temperature of 11°C/52°F.
Montana, United States's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Revere, Massachusetts's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F).
On average across the year, yes, Montana, United States is colder than Revere, Massachusetts . Montana, United States has an average minimum temperature of 0°C/32°F and Revere, Massachusetts has an average minimum temperature of 6°C/43°F.
On average across the year,
no, Montana, United States has less rain than
Revere, Massachusetts. Montana, United States has an average annual rainfall of 509mm and Revere, Massachusetts has an average annual rainfall of 1446mm.
Montana, United States's wettest month is May, with an average monthly rainfall of 69mm, which is drier than Revere, Massachusetts's wettest month (October, with an average monthly rainfall of 167mm).
